JQ中height() 方法返回或設(shè)置匹配元素的高度。(div).height(300);//直接設(shè)置元素的高 (div).css(height, 300px);//通過設(shè)置CSS屬性來設(shè)置元素的高 Jquery是一個(gè)優(yōu)秀的Javascript庫,還兼容各種瀏覽器。
成都創(chuàng)新互聯(lián)公司長期為成百上千家客戶提供的網(wǎng)站建設(shè)服務(wù),團(tuán)隊(duì)從業(yè)經(jīng)驗(yàn)10年,關(guān)注不同地域、不同群體,并針對不同對象提供差異化的產(chǎn)品和服務(wù);打造開放共贏平臺(tái),與合作伙伴共同營造健康的互聯(lián)網(wǎng)生態(tài)環(huán)境。為吐魯番企業(yè)提供專業(yè)的網(wǎng)站建設(shè)、做網(wǎng)站,吐魯番網(wǎng)站改版等技術(shù)服務(wù)。擁有10多年豐富建站經(jīng)驗(yàn)和眾多成功案例,為您定制開發(fā)。
高度的話,你可以設(shè)置height:auto。一般是寬度有異議。因?yàn)橐苿?dòng)端設(shè)備寬度不一樣,所以會(huì)出現(xiàn)排版的困難,一般采用響應(yīng)式布局,設(shè)置多套css。而字體的話。
我剛才測試了一下,能夠正常使用tab。但是你應(yīng)該在css里面加上 contents_2,#contents_3 之外。我不清楚你有沒有聲明DOCTYPE.順便說一下啊,jqueryui點(diǎn)抗 提供tabs.js插件,能夠符合你百分之九十九的需求,你可以看一下。
新建一個(gè)html文件,命名為test.html,用于講解jquery怎么設(shè)置div高度。 在test.html文件內(nèi),引入jquery.min.js庫文件,成功加載該文件,才能使用jquery中的方法。
若有浮動(dòng),先清除浮動(dòng),再用$(div).height()。
此方法的好處就是不需要知道DIV的具體寬度和高度大小,直接用jQuery就可以實(shí)現(xiàn)水平和垂直居中,而且兼容各瀏覽器,這個(gè)方法在很多的彈出層效果中應(yīng)用。注意事項(xiàng):方法二的前提是必需設(shè)置DIV的寬度和高度。
1、JQ中height() 方法返回或設(shè)置匹配元素的高度。(div).height(300);//直接設(shè)置元素的高 (div).css(height, 300px);//通過設(shè)置CSS屬性來設(shè)置元素的高 Jquery是一個(gè)優(yōu)秀的Javascript庫,還兼容各種瀏覽器。
2、js里面提供了很多的方法,可以計(jì)算DIV的高度,以及也可以給DIV直接復(fù)制。
3、若有浮動(dòng),先清除浮動(dòng),再用$(div).height()。
4、出現(xiàn)這種情況,只能說你的處理不合理。jQuery操作的是DOM對象而不是html標(biāo)簽代碼。jQuery(table) 是jQuery(document.createElement(table))的縮寫。所以你還是從新整理,輸出完整的標(biāo)簽后,向里邊append。
新建一個(gè)html文件。為了更好區(qū)分,會(huì)創(chuàng)建兩個(gè)按鈕標(biāo)簽,然后給這兩個(gè)按鈕標(biāo)簽添加不同的id。引入jquery文件(注:jquery的引入路徑一定要正確)。創(chuàng)建加載完成函數(shù),然后創(chuàng)建一個(gè)點(diǎn)擊按鈕獲取當(dāng)前id的函數(shù)。
若有浮動(dòng),先清除浮動(dòng),再用$(div).height()。
方法介紹:使用innerHeight()方法:獲取第一個(gè)匹配元素內(nèi)部區(qū)域?qū)挾龋òㄑa(bǔ)白、不包括邊框)使用height()方法 取得匹配元素當(dāng)前計(jì)算的高度值(px)。
div.scrollHeight 就可以了。但是這里有個(gè)問題,如果內(nèi)容撐出去了,那么這個(gè)scrollHeight就是內(nèi)容的高度,如果內(nèi)容高度沒有div的高度高的話,scrollHeight的值就是div的高。
JQ中height() 方法返回或設(shè)置匹配元素的高度。(div).height(300);//直接設(shè)置元素的高 (div).css(height, 300px);//通過設(shè)置CSS屬性來設(shè)置元素的高 Jquery是一個(gè)優(yōu)秀的Javascript庫,還兼容各種瀏覽器。
好吧,我想說的是offsetHeight是js對象所能支持的方法,而$(div:eq(1))所獲得的是一個(gè)JQUERY對象,他是不支持offsetHeight的。